In his State of the Union address, the president urged Democrats and Republicans to let temperatures cool and take another look at the legislation that passed the House and Senate last year. Obama said his administration and Congress have gotten closer than ever to insuring millions more.
The legislation is stalled in Congress after Democrats lost a Massachusetts Senate seat last week and their filibuster-proof majority.
Obama said: "Do not walk away from reform. Not now. Not when we are so close. Let us find a way to come together and finish the job for the American people."
Obama also asked lawmakers to pass an energy and climate bill that he says will create jobs.
